Team Zama wins season 8 of the Tusker Lite Friday Night Lights

Yesterday, marked the climax of the eighth season of Tusker Lite Friday Night Lights (FNL) which will not be forgotten at all.

Fans and players walked away with several goodies that included; cash, power banks, headphones, kits & flat screens among things.

Team Zama became the new champion of the exciting edition after it broke Team Ikong’s heart in the fading seconds of the final.

Team Zama won the exciting final 21-20 and was awarded a cash prize of Shs1.5M while first runners up Team Ikong bagged Shs1M.

That was not all, the second and third runners up did not go with bare pockets as Team Flirsh and Team Madol got Shs500,000 and Shs250,000 respectively. Team Flirsh beat Madol 21-17 in the third playoff tie.

DJ Simples treated revellers to the best music as the games went on as famous energetic and awesome musician, Nina Roz excited fans when she stepped on stage to perform her hits. All we can do now is wait for season nine

Semi final results

Team Madol 15 -20 Team Zama

Team Ikong 21-13Team Flirsh

Third place play off

Team Madol 18-21 Team Flirsh

Final result

Team Ikong 20-21Team Zama
